Fig 1.

Evaluation of plasma concentrations of urea (A) and HCit (B) in WT (grey bars) and MPO-/- (open bars) mice.

Values were expressed as means ± standard deviations. Statistical significance was determined by Two-way ANOVA followed by Tukey’s multiple comparisons test. **: p < 0.01, ***: p < 0.0001, (ns) non-significant.

Fig 2.

HCit accumulation in skin (A) and aorta (B) of WT and MPO-/- mice.

Dark lines represent the evolution of average HCit values at each age while grey areas represent 95% confidence intervals of the values.
